| Issuer | Grand Duchy of Lithuania |
|---|---|
| Year | 1565-1566 |
| Type | Standard circulation coin |
| Value | 3 Groats |
| Currency | Lithuanian Groat (1495-1580) |
| Composition | Silver (.875) |
| Weight | 3.00 g |
| Diameter | 22 mm |

| Reference(s) | Ig#V.65, Ig#V.66, Kop#3308, Kop#3309, Gum#623 |
| Obverse description | Knight on horse brandishing sword and charging left. Value in Roman numerals below horse. |
|---|---|
| Obverse script | Latin |
| Obverse lettering | SIGISM AVG REX POL MAG DVX LIT III |
| Reverse description | Four line inscription, date divided by crowned monogram below. |
| Reverse script | Latin |
| Reverse lettering |
QVI HABITAT IN COELIS IRRI DEBIT EOS 15 (_) 65 (Translation: Quote from Bible Psalm 2:4 The One enthroned in heaven laughs ... at them.) |
